Question
Hello Cynthia Wolfe,

My name is Hector I'm 27 male Looking to get into a culinary school in my area but most are very expensive and I don't know if I can go through it cause of my ADD. Do you know of any Gov. help? Or any but that could help me?

Hope you can help me or direct me to some that might.

Thank you for your time,

Hector  

Answer
Hello Hector,

Thanks for asking a question. Some culinary schools are accredited and some are not. If you choose an accredited school, you may be eligible for assistance through grants and loans by the federal government. Research culinary schools, and then fill out the FAFSA, using this website: http://www.fafsa.ed.gov

The school you choose may also have some financial aid options. Check out their website and/or call them. If you have not seen a doctor for your ADD, do that soon as medication may improve your quality of life and make achieving a degree a greater possibility.

Education is expensive - not just culinary schools! It is not unusual for students to graduate with loan debt accumulated during their studies. Don't forget to look around for scholarships, too!
